The Berlin-based record label Voitax is gearing up for a notable release as MXC’s highly anticipated EP, ‘Tik Tik,’ hits the scene. This collaboration marks the fusion of Maroki and Coralie’s unique musical perspectives, cast during the challenges of a world in lockdown.
MXC’s EP, ‘Tik Tik’, is a testament to creative resilience, presenting a sonic journey through uncharted territories of drum and bass. Crafted meticulously in two separate studios during a year marked by isolation and introspection, the EP showcases MXC’s versatile artistry. From the repurposed grime breakbeat hybrid of ‘Tik Tik’ to the relentless industrial chug of ‘Swarm’ and the delicate balance between IDM and club-focused broken drum & bass in ‘Aiven’ and ‘Crabby,’ each track captivates with intricate complexity. The EP culminates in the IDM exploration of ‘PS,’ where Maroki’s vocals intertwine with synths, creating a poignant finale that leaves a lasting imprint on listeners.

Amidst the global pandemic, MXC, consisting of Maroki and Coralie, forged a digital connection to push the boundaries of their sound. Walking a tightrope between introspective club music and avant-garde experimentation, MXC transcends genre limitations with a distinctive sound. Despite never physically sharing the same space, Maroki and Coralie work separately to craft their individual parts, preserving the sanctity of their creative flow. This unorthodox approach yields a musical tapestry defying convention and explanation, encapsulating MXC’s collective vision in an uncondensed format. Inspired by dimly lit clubs and the uncharted territories of sound design, MXC explores shadows, drawing from grime, acid, psy, and UK bass to infuse their productions with grit and intensity. Cover Artwork:
Hailing from a fashion design background and moonlighting as a visual artist, this Chen Kai-en’s work is marked by a handmade aesthetic, collage elements, repeated patterns, and a fusion of colors and textures. Inspired by everyday landscapes, particularly in local Taiwanese communities, the artist delves into the unconventional charm of “Taiwanese character” and life’s unpredictability.
